The OPPO Find X9 Ultra is expected to arrive in the coming weeks. However, that’s not the only device OPPO is working on. A new leak suggests that the company has a tablet and compact waiting in the wings.
According to reliable Weibo tipster Digital Chat Station (DCS), OPPO has two devices currently in development. One of those devices appears to be a compact phone with a MediaTek Dimensity 9500 chip. This phone is said to come in four configurations: 12GB of RAM + 256 GB of storage, 12GB of RAM + 512 GB of storage, 16GB of RAM + 512 GB of storage, and 16GB of RAM + 1 TB of storage. It may also be available in four color options: Titanium, White, Cyan, and Orange. DCS does not mention the name of the phone, but it’s possible this could be the Find X9s.
Meanwhile, the other device is said to be a flagship tablet that carries the model number OPD2511. It appears this tablet may support 67W fast charging and will be available in three colors: Monet Purple, Dawn Gold, and Mocha Brown. Similar to the phone, this tablet has four configurations: 8GB+256GB, 12GB+256GB, 12GB+512GB, 16GB+512GB. The tipster adds that they’ve only seen a Wi-Fi version of the tablet.
Speaking of the OPPO Find X9s, the phone has previously been spotted in a Thai certification database. That listing revealed that the Find X9s has the model number CPH2873.
